/**
* @fileoverview Disallow Labeled Statements
* @author Nicholas C. Zakas
*/
"use strict";
//------------------------------------------------------------------------------
// Requirements
//------------------------------------------------------------------------------
const astUtils = require("./utils/ast-utils");
//------------------------------------------------------------------------------
// Rule Definition
//------------------------------------------------------------------------------
/** @type {import('../shared/types').Rule} */
module.exports = {
meta: {
type: "suggestion",
docs: {
description: "Disallow labeled statements",
recommended: false,
url: "https://eslint.org/docs/latest/rules/no-labels"
},
schema: [
{
type: "object",
properties: {
allowLoop: {
type: "boolean",
default: false
},
allowSwitch: {
type: "boolean",
default: false
}
},
additionalProperties: false
}
],
messages: {
unexpectedLabel: "Unexpected labeled statement.",
unexpectedLabelInBreak: "Unexpected label in break statement.",
unexpectedLabelInContinue: "Unexpected label in continue statement."
}
},
create(context) {
const options = context.options[0];
const allowLoop = options && options.allowLoop;
const allowSwitch = options && options.allowSwitch;
let scopeInfo = null;
/**
* Gets the kind of a given node.
* @param {ASTNode} node A node to get.
* @returns {string} The kind of the node.
*/
function getBodyKind(node) {
if (astUtils.isLoop(node)) {
return "loop";
}
if (node.type === "SwitchStatement") {
return "switch";
}
return "other";
}
/**
* Checks whether the label of a given kind is allowed or not.
* @param {string} kind A kind to check.
* @returns {boolean} `true` if the kind is allowed.
*/
function isAllowed(kind) {
switch (kind) {
case "loop": return allowLoop;
case "switch": return allowSwitch;
default: return false;
}
}
/**
* Checks whether a given name is a label of a loop or not.
* @param {string} label A name of a label to check.
* @returns {boolean} `true` if the name is a label of a loop.
*/
function getKind(label) {
let info = scopeInfo;
while (info) {
if (info.label === label) {
return info.kind;
}
info = info.upper;
}
/* c8 ignore next */
return "other";
}
//--------------------------------------------------------------------------
// Public
//--------------------------------------------------------------------------
return {
LabeledStatement(node) {
scopeInfo = {
label: node.label.name,
kind: getBodyKind(node.body),
upper: scopeInfo
};
},
"LabeledStatement:exit"(node) {
if (!isAllowed(scopeInfo.kind)) {
context.report({
node,
messageId: "unexpectedLabel"
});
}
scopeInfo = scopeInfo.upper;
},
BreakStatement(node) {
if (node.label && !isAllowed(getKind(node.label.name))) {
context.report({
node,
messageId: "unexpectedLabelInBreak"
});
}
},
ContinueStatement(node) {
if (node.label && !isAllowed(getKind(node.label.name))) {
context.report({
node,
messageId: "unexpectedLabelInContinue"
});
}
}
};
}
};
